时间:2024-10-10 来源:网络 人气:
随着信息化时代的到来,超市作为日常生活的必需品供应地,其信息管理系统的建设显得尤为重要。本文将介绍如何使用C语言开发一个超市信息管理系统,包括系统设计、功能实现以及运行效果。
超市信息管理系统旨在提高超市运营效率,降低管理成本,提升顾客购物体验。系统设计主要包括以下几个方面:
商品信息管理:包括商品信息的录入、查询、修改和删除。
库存管理:实现库存的实时监控,包括库存的增减、查询和预警。
销售管理:记录销售数据,包括销售金额、销售数量等,并生成销售报表。
用户管理:实现管理员和普通用户的权限管理。
以下将详细介绍超市信息管理系统的功能实现。
2.1 商品信息管理
商品信息管理模块主要包括以下功能:
商品信息录入:通过结构体定义商品信息,包括商品编号、名称、品牌、价格、库存等。
商品信息查询:根据商品编号、名称、品牌等条件查询商品信息。
商品信息修改:修改已录入的商品信息。
商品信息删除:删除不需要的商品信息。
2.2 库存管理
库存管理模块主要包括以下功能:
库存增减:根据销售、进货等操作实时更新库存数量。
库存查询:查询商品库存数量,包括库存预警功能。
库存报表:生成库存报表,包括库存数量、库存金额等。
2.3 销售管理
销售管理模块主要包括以下功能:
销售记录:记录销售数据,包括销售时间、销售金额、销售数量等。
销售报表:生成销售报表,包括销售金额、销售数量、销售排行等。
2.4 用户管理
用户管理模块主要包括以下功能:
管理员登录:管理员通过用户名和密码登录系统。
权限管理:管理员可以设置普通用户的权限,包括商品信息管理、库存管理、销售管理等。
以下展示超市信息管理系统的运行效果。